Dutch Braids Short Hair: Messy Dutch Braids Short Hair
Messy Dutch braids for short hair offer a relaxed and effortlessly chic way to wear braids. This style is all about creating a loose and slightly undone braid, giving it a casual and tousled appearance, and is a great way to style Dutch braids short hair. The key to achieving this look is not to make the braids too perfect. You can pull out a few strands of hair after completing the braid to make it even more relaxed. This look works great for those who prefer styles that look lived in and free. The style is both fun and easy.
